Output e8d35eeca55adc99d7ab52ea55a644f59cd1ee8cc1ffef9430ef686b73274413:71

value
109277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 236fc715693a0fd9a26e79ca13fefe056f3cf3a8 OP_EQUAL
address
34vPUhvyZmDLuKyzexX29kH8SPAdcD62Kf
transaction
e8d35eeca55adc99d7ab52ea55a644f59cd1ee8cc1ffef9430ef686b73274413
confirmations
200001
spent
true